Ph.D. PROGRAM<br />
Doctoral program in Environmental Science was successfully launched in 2003.<br />
Learning OBJECTIVES<br />
To inculcate in depth knowledge about particular environmental issues and train to use<br />
advanced technologies and procedures to analyze the environmental problems and finding<br />
the solutions<br />
Outcomes <strong>of</strong> this EDUCATION<br />
• Experiences in academic and applied research<br />
• Pr<strong>of</strong>essional and scientific attitude towards environmental problems and solutions<br />
Scheme <strong>of</strong> STUDIES<br />
• Total 18 Credits course work in two semesters (9 credits teaching in Semester I and<br />
9 Credits teaching in Semester II). (The courses will be <strong>of</strong>fered according to the area<br />
<strong>of</strong> specialization opted by the candidate)<br />
• Comprehensive Examination is compulsory prior to the approval <strong>of</strong> synopsis.<br />
Eligibility CRITERIA<br />
• Minimum 18 years <strong>of</strong> education<br />
(M.Phil OR MS OR Equivalent)<br />
in the subject <strong>of</strong> Environmental<br />
Science/ Botany/ Zoology/<br />
Chemistry/Physics/Agriculture/<br />
MBBS/Pharmacy/Geography/<br />
Wild life and Fisheries is required.<br />
• All other requirements as per<br />
university policy (Please see<br />
<strong>University</strong> Admission Eligibility<br />
Criteria <strong>for</strong> Ph.D Program).<br />
Environmental Science<br />
SPECIALIZATION OFFERED<br />
• Environment and Health<br />
• Environmental Monitoring<br />
• Occupational Health & Safety<br />
• Environmental Chemistry<br />
• Environmental Biotechnology<br />
• Environmental Toxicology<br />
There could be more specializations depending upon<br />
the availability <strong>of</strong> the faculty<br />
